Frequently Asked Questions

How many ETFs hold OKE?
ONEOK, Inc. (OKE) is held by 239 ETFs (excluding leveraged and inverse funds). The largest position by market value is in SCHD (Schwab U.S. Dividend Equity ETF).
What is the largest ETF that holds OKE?
By fund size, SCHD (Schwab U.S. Dividend Equity ETF) with $110.53B in AUM holds 1.52% of its portfolio in OKE, representing $1.68B in market value.
What percentage of MLPX is OKE?
OKE makes up 6.49% of MLPX (Global X - MLP & Energy Infrastructure ETF), making it one of the largest positions in that fund.
Is OKE in the S&P 500?
Yes, OKE is a component of the S&P 500 index, held by S&P 500 ETFs including SPY and VOO.
